Quantum well field effect transistors have been proposed as promising device candidates for future high-speed and low-power logic applications due to their high electron mobility. This paper aims to study InAs and InGaAs state-of-the-art QWFETs, investigating both RF and DC performance through our full band Cellular Monte Carlo simulator, which includes the full details of the band structure and the phonon spectra. A complete characterization of these devices has been performed using experimental data to calibrate the simulation parameters.
